Dr. Wei Zhao

Title: Challenges and Opportunities of Computing Education and Research

Abstract:

Computing and networking systems have been widely used in almost every sector of society. However, they are limited by their capabilities in terms of security, reliability, performance, and scale-ability. We will discuss the various challenges posed by the design and implementation of the computing and networking systems. We will introduce several major initiatives taken which aim to address these challenges. Examples of such initiatives include the Cyber-Enabled Discovery and Innovation.

Dr. L.G. Chen

Title: The Evolution of Ambient SOC and its Impact to Embedded System

Abstract:

The development of semiconductor technology plays a key role for the coming digital life. The integration of nano-technology and communication technology creates the convergence and divergence of rich remarkable applications. System-on-chip (SOC) offers highly cost-effective performance with power saving features and becomes the most feasible solution for ICT products. To meet the performance and time-to-market requirements, platform base design with embedded system has been developed. Recently, more and more ubiquitous devices and sensors are integrated into SOC to provide more convenient and interactive capability of ICT applications. This is indeed the realization of ambient era. In this talk, the evolution of semiconductor, communication and ambient technologies will be addressed. The roadmap and progressing of those developments will be described. Last but not least, what will be the impact to embedded system because of the rapid growth of Ambient SOC will also be expressed.
